Hi there, @Chrisng. Welcome to the Fitbit Community Forums. I'm sorry to hear that the screen of your Charge 5 is still blank despite the restart you performed. I'll do my best to help you with this.
While reading your post I was wondering if the Charge 5 vibrated when you attempted the restart? If it didn't, it looks to me that your Charge 5 ran out of battery and that's why it's not responding to anything.
Sometimes a Fitbit doesn’t seem to be charging when actually the issue is that it has become unresponsive (this can happen if the battery has been allowed to discharge completely). I'd recommend putting it on to charge on a charging wire and outlet known to be working. Leave it on the charger for a good two hours, even if it doesn’t seem to be charging.
When it has had two hours, try restarting your Charge 5. I would recommend trying this maybe twice in a row if a first try doesn’t work.
Let me know how it goes.

This what I found here in the Netherlands about the answer from Fitbit to all the problems:
As a solution for affected consumers, Fitbit customer service is reportedly offering a 35% discount code towards the purchase of a new Fitbit device, provided your Charge 5 is still under warranty. If not, there is no solution. Unfortunately, there also doesn't seem to be a way to prevent the Charge 5 from updating automatically. We don't know if the update has been discontinued as reports of issues are still coming in.
